Orange flame-like light crept over the cabin's. One of the few beautiful things that remained in this apocalyptic world was the Sunrises. Scarlets and Violets wisped through the amber. It woke up Cas, he grinned like there was nothing better in the world and truth be told, in that moment there wasn't to him.
Dean had noticed that Cas looked... well happy, more than that actually. A real smile was dawning on his face and there was a returned light inside Cas' once vibrant blue eyes that had left with his Grace.
"You good?" Dean asked
"Yes. Gabriel was with me last night"
Dean pulled a hard face "How?"
"I don't know but I'm sure it was him"
Dean nodded and smirked a bit, he didn't fully believe that Gabriel was back but there was no way in absolute Hell would he drag down Cas' great mood "So, you think you're up helping us again? It's been harder without you watching our backs"
"Fine. I could do with some air"
Dean finally noticed how exhausted Cas had appeared even if he wasn't yawning or his eyes were dropping
"You lose some hours?" Dean questioned as Cas left to get changed into 'battle armour'.
"A few, yeah. But like I said, Gabriel was here and made it better"
Dean still couldn't contemplate Gabriel actually being around but his thoughts were interrupted by Cas returning pulling on his army green coat
"So, what's on the agenda today?"
"Simple supply run. We've found a large Quiet Zone that should have plenty of supplies that we could return to more than once"
"Great, so... wheels up in ten?"
"No, now. I only need two men for this job and right now I could stretch my legs" Dean took the driver's side. Gears turned in Cas' head until he caught on
"Oh, right. Got it"
Dean chuckled as Cas tucked himself in shotgun, both Dean and Cas had taken handguns with them, it was a Quiet Zone but they weren't stupid.
Finding enough to last a week the two were back within a few hours. They were met with Rami and Louis arguing
"What's going on?" Dean demanded jumping out the jeep.
"Some arrogant dick waltzed in, took over the entire head cabin and locked us out from the inside, repeatedly saying 'I need to speak to Castiel and only Castiel'. No-one has been able to get in"
"Cas, with me" Dean ordered "The rest of you, find vantage points and aim for the door. do not fire unless you hear us shoot first"
Dean tried the door but it wouldn't budge, no matter how hard he rammed his shoulder into it "Son of a Bitch" he hissed
"They said he wanted to talk to me, think I could try?"
"Sure," Dean stepped away and aimed his gun at the door as Cas turned the handle, it complied, Dean was the first to go in with Cas right behind him, in retaliation the door slammed behind them.
"So? This is how you welcome back family?" A familiar voice called out.
Both Winchester and Novak's jaws fell, it couldn't be...
"Gabriel?" As if Cas had wings flung himself into his Gabriel's awaiting arms within a second of eye contact, Gabriel acted as if winded, curling his arms around his younger sibling's shaking body.
"Baby Brother, you really thought I'd leave you alone like that?"
Cas just squeezed Gabriel tighter. He began to break down and cry into Gabriel's shoulder.
"Shh, shh, shh. I'm here now. I'm sorry Cas" Gabriel hushed, rubbing his Brother's back soothingly as they rocked side to side.
Dean didn't want to ruin the moment and left, ordering everyone to stand down. They did, though confused, Dean explained that it was a personal matter and questions didn't continue.
Meanwhile Cas continued to sob into his Brother's body.
"I've missed you so much," Cas shuddered
"I know, I've missed you too, but there's a little problem baby Bro," Gabriel started already feeling Cas' grip intense "I can't stay long. It took a lot of energy and sneaking around just to say goodbye. I still hear you little Brother, you need to talk and I'll try my damnedest to reply to you" Gabriel gasped holding Cas just as firmly "They found me, Cas, let go I have to leave you"
"No, please... I don't want you to. I was happy, for today I was happy. I don't want to lose that"
"I don't want that either, Cassie. I love you and I'll see you soon, yeah?"
"I'll be accepted back into Heaven?"
"Of course. I'll be there to escort you back into our old nest and together you and I can stay there together forever"
"Really?" Cas couldn't stop his voice cracking.
"Yeah, you'll be an Angel again. Promise" Gabriel began to release his grip, he kissed his Brother's temple "Try to stay happy little Brother"
"Okay..." Cas took a deep breath and spoke in Enochian "I cherish and love you, big Brother Gabriel"
Pride swelled in Gabriel's chest as he saved the heart-warming look on Castiel's face.
"I love you too, baby Brother" With that Gabriel vanished.
For the rest of the day Cas had lost his good mood.
Dean made sure he was at least OK before the night ended.
